Learn more about our <a href="https://hrportal.ehr.com/applied/" target="_blank"><span><u>benefits</u></span></a>. </p><p></p><p><b>Job Summary:</b></p><p>We are seeking a <b>Product Technical Expert (PTE)</b> to join our <b>Product Management</b> team, focused on the development of next-generation semiconductor manufacturing equipment. The PTE will serve as the <b>technical and strategic lead</b> for a specific product line, ensuring alignment between customer requirements, engineering design, and manufacturing capabilities. This role is critical in driving innovation, accelerating time-to-market, and ensuring product performance and reliability in high-precision, high-complexity environments.</p><div></div><p><b>Key Responsibilities:</b></p><ul><li><span>Serve as the </span><b>technical owner</b><span> of a product line within operations division throughout the product lifecycle (from NPI to volume production).</span></li><li><span>Work closely with the </span><b>industrial and supplier engineering</b><span> teams to evaluate and qualify components, ensuring they meet technical, quality, and cost requirements. Analyze component suitability and integration into the overall system architecture.</span></li><li><span>Drive </span><b>design for manufacturability (DFM)</b><span> to optimize cost, quality, and uptime.</span></li><li><span>Upscaling, running </span><b>AI initiatives </b><span>for optimization</span></li><li><span>Support </span><b>prototype builds</b><span>, </span><b>system integration </b><span>during NPI phase.</span></li><li><span>Support continuous</span><b> improvement</b><span> and </span><b>design enhancements</b><span> in collaboration with R&D and manufacturing divisions</span></li><li><span>Maintain comprehensive </span><b>technical documentation</b><span>, including Change Management via engineering change orders (ECOs).</span></li><li><span>Stay current with </span><b>semiconductor industry trends</b><span>, competitive technologies, and emerging process requirements.</span></li></ul><p></p><p><b>Qualifications:</b></p><ul><li><span>Bachelor’s or master’s degree in mechanical, Electrical, Mechatronics, or Systems Engineering.</span></li><li><b>Profound</b><span> experience in product development within the </span><b>semiconductor equipment</b><span> or </span><b>high-tech capital equipment</b><span> industry.</span></li><li><span>Strong understanding of </span><b>semiconductor manufacturing processes</b><span> (e.g., lithography, etch, deposition, metrology).</span></li><li><span>Experience with </span><b>vacuum systems</b><span>, </span><b>robotics</b><span>, </span><b>high voltage management</b><span>, or </span><b>precision motion control</b><span> is highly desirable.</span></li><li><span>Excellent communication and leadership skills with a proven ability to work cross-functionally in a global environment.</span></li><li><span>Knowledge in </span><b>CAD tools</b><span> (e.g., SolidWorks, NX), </span><b>PLM systems</b><span>, </span><b>LEAN methods</b><span>, </span><b>SAP</b><span> knowledge is an added advantage</span></li></ul><p style="text-align:inherit"></p><p style="text-align:inherit"></p><p style="text-align:left"><b>Additional Information</b></p><p style="text-align:inherit"></p><p style="text-align:left"><b>Time Type:</b></p>Full time<p style="text-align:inherit"></p><p style="text-align:left"><b>Employee Type:</b></p>Assignee / Regular<p style="text-align:inherit"></p><p style="text-align:left"><b>Travel:</b></p>Yes, 10% of the Time<p style="text-align:inherit"></p><p style="text-align:left"><b>Relocation Eligible:</b></p>No<br /><br /><p>The salary offered to a selected candidate will be based on multiple factors including location, hire grade, job-related knowledge, skills, experience, and with consideration of internal equity of our current team members.
